Tomato leaf curl New Delhi virus (ToLCNDV) poses a major threat to cucurbit crops. Ning Qiao et al. developed a UDG-LAMP-LFD assay, creating a dependable diagnostic tool for surveillance of ToLCNDV and early detection of the virus on cucurbit seedlings: https://doi.org/10.1094/PDIS-07-25-1386-RE
Gray mold, caused by the fungus #Botrytis cinerea, significantly reduces tomato yield and quality. Jane Marian Luis et al. evaluated the antifungal effect of cinnamon essential oil nanoemulsion against B. cinerea: https://doi.org/10.1094/PDIS-02-25-0261-RE #plantdisease

First identified in Los Angeles in 2012, citrus #huanglongbing has since spread through residential areas across Southern California. Weiqi Luo et al. developed a geospatial risk-based survey model for ‘Candidatus Liberibacter asiaticus’ detection: https://doi.org/10.1094/PDIS-01-25-0075-RE
Strawberry Fusarium wilt is threatening the Chinese strawberry industry. Guo-Fang Zhang et al. present the first report of #Fusarium oxysporum f. sp. fragariae as a causal agent of strawberry Fusarium wilt in Zhejiang, China: https://doi.org/10.1094/PDIS-05-25-1007-SR #plantdisease
To evaluate hemp germplasm for susceptibility to #Septoria leaf spot, Jocelyn A. Schwartz et al. evaluated hemp entries from the USDA-ARS Plant Genetic Resources Unit, commercially available cultivars, and Cornell breeding lines in replicated field trials: https://doi.org/10.1094/PDIS-07-25-1367-RE
